The exposure ages of samples collected from the shore platforms along volcanic islands (Dokdo) in the middle of the East Sea range from the mid-Holocene(ca. 4 ka) to the last century (ca. 0.1 ka). The large range in ages along the outer platform edges may be related to stochastic, differential,and mechanical wave erosion. We also calculated the rates of vertical lowering from the 36Cl concentrations of the platform surfaces, yielding a maximum rate, excluding outliers, of 0.68 mm/yr (Geoscience Journal, in press)
